Odell Beckham Jr. tells The Post why his Giants return was ‘everything I was expecting’

exclusive New York Giants Odell Beckham Jr. tells The Post why his Giants return was ‘everything I was expecting’ By Ryan Dunleavy Published Aug. 15, 2026, 8:03 p.m. ET Giants wide receiver Odell Beckham Jr. runs a pattern during the first half of the Giants' 13-10 preseason loss to the Vikings on Aug. 15, 2026 at MetLife Stadium. Bill Kostroun / New York Post One of the loudest cheers Saturday at MetLife Stadium came in between two nondescript second-quarter carries by Dante Miller.

What happened? Odell Beckham Jr. checked into the game for the Giants for the first time since Dec. 2, 2018.

“It was everything I was expecting it to be,” Beckham told The Post after the Giants lost 13-10 to the Vikings in the preseason opener. “Just the love to be able to be back here in a place I’ve done special things. It was a special moment with a lot of emotions going into it, so you kind of have to check them and make sure you don’t burn too much energy too early.”

Making his first appearance in a Giants uniform since he was still a phenom, Beckham soaked in the pregame juice as fans shouted his name in the corner of the end zone where he caught passes and bobbed his head during warmups. He ran over and hugged his son, who is part of the inspiration for his return to the Giants and the family message that “Beckhams Don’t Quit.”
